He’Atid Hurricanes Edge Moriah Lions in Overtime Thriller

A dramatic comeback and a golden goal deliver a 4‑3 victory in the quarterfinals

On May 12, the sixth‑seeded He’Atid Hurricanes faced the third‑seeded Moriah Lions in a tightly contested quarterfinal playoff match that would go the distance.

Clutch Performances Define the Series

The Hurricanes opened the scoring early, with Ava Davidson finding the net before Chloe Carmen extended the lead to 3‑1, showcasing a swift start that put Moriah on the back foot.

Moriah refused to fold, rallying with two unanswered goals to tie the game at 3‑3 and force overtime, setting the stage for a dramatic finish.

In the extra period, goaltender Sophia Farbowitz made several key saves, preserving the Hurricanes’ chances and allowing Maytal Hartstein to strike the game‑winning “golden goal” that sealed a 4‑3 victory.

The win was overseen by coaches Ari Wolf and Jason Farbowitz, whose strategic adjustments proved decisive in the high‑pressure final minutes.
